Shifty Shellshock, Frontman of Crazy Town, Dies at 50

Los Angeles County Medical Examiner Confirms Death

Seth "Shifty Shellshock" Binzer, the frontman of the rap rock band Crazy Town, has died at the age of 50. The death was confirmed by the Los Angeles County Medical Examiner.

Cause of Death Pending

The cause of death has not yet been released. However, Binzer had a long history of substance abuse and mental health issues. In 2010, he was arrested for possession of methamphetamine and cocaine.

Crazy Town's Success

Crazy Town released their debut album, The Gift & the Curse, in 2000. The album was a commercial success, spawning the hit single "Butterfly." The band followed up with their sophomore album, Darkhorse, in 2002, but it failed to match the success of their debut.

Personal Struggles

Binzer's personal life was troubled. He was arrested numerous times for drug-related offenses and served time in prison. He also struggled with mental health issues and attempted suicide several times.

Binzer's death is a tragic loss for the music community. He was a talented musician who helped define the sound of rap rock in the early 2000s. His legacy will continue through his music.
